MySQL事务处理错误:场景分析及解决方案
在MySQL的事务处理中,可能会遇到各种错误。以下是一个常见的场景分析和解决方案:
错误场景:
提交事务时失败: 由于数据库操作(如插入数据、更新等)出现异常,导致无法提交事务。
回滚事务时错误: 在需要回滚事务的情况下,可能出现执行失败的问题。
解决方案:
检查并修复异常: 在遇到提交失败的场景时,首先要定位到出现问题的具体操作。若是因为数据格式不正确、已存在相同记录等引起的,需进行相应的修改。
处理回滚错误: 回滚事务出错时,应确保在回滚前已将相关的事务状态锁定,避免回滚过程中再次发生异常。如果是因为事务锁的问题,需要检查并调整相关配置。
总结来说,解决MySQL事务处理错误的关键在于定位问题、修复异常以及合理管理事务状态。
还没有评论,来说两句吧...